The Effects of Hard Water on Your Plumbing System
Tough water, a typical concern in several homes, can have substantial influence on plumbing systems. Recognizing these results is critical for maintaining the longevity and effectiveness of your pipelines and components.

Introduction


Difficult water is water that contains high degrees of dissolved minerals, primarily calcium and magnesium. These minerals are safe to human health and wellness however can damage plumbing infrastructure in time. Let's look into how difficult water influences pipelines and what you can do concerning it.

What is Hard Water?


Hard water is characterized by its mineral web content, specifically calcium and magnesium ions. These minerals enter the water supply as it percolates via sedimentary rock and chalk deposits underground. When tough water is warmed or left to stand, it tends to form range, a crusty accumulation that sticks to surfaces and can cause a variety of problems in plumbing systems.

Effect on Piping


Tough water impacts pipes in a number of detrimental means, primarily with scale buildup, lowered water circulation, and raised deterioration.

Range Buildup


One of the most typical issues brought on by hard water is scale buildup inside pipes and fixtures. As water moves via the plumbing system, minerals precipitate out and follow the pipeline walls. With time, this accumulation can tighten pipeline openings, causing lowered water circulation and raised stress on the system.

Minimized Water Flow


Mineral deposits from tough water can progressively decrease the diameter of pipelines, restricting water circulation to faucets, showers, and appliances. This minimized flow not just impacts water stress however additionally boosts energy usage as appliances like water heaters must work harder to provide the very same amount of warm water.

Deterioration


While hard water minerals themselves do not trigger deterioration, they can exacerbate existing rust concerns in pipelines. Scale accumulation can catch water versus steel surface areas, accelerating the corrosion process and potentially causing leakages or pipeline failing gradually.

Device Damages


Past pipelines, difficult water can additionally harm house devices connected to the water supply. Appliances such as hot water heater, dish washers, and cleaning makers are particularly susceptible to range build-up. This can decrease their efficiency, rise upkeep costs, and reduce their life expectancy.

Checking and Treatment


Testing for tough water and carrying out suitable therapy procedures is essential to mitigating its results on pipes and devices.

Water Softeners


Water conditioners are the most typical solution for dealing with tough water. They work by trading calcium and magnesium ions with sodium or potassium ions, successfully lowering the firmness of the water.

Various Other Therapy Alternatives


Along with water conditioners, other therapy choices consist of magnetic water conditioners, reverse osmosis systems, and chemical additives. Each technique has its advantages and suitability depending on the severity of the tough water trouble and family requirements.

Flush Your Water Heater Regularly



Hard water can cause sediment buildup in your water heater, reducing its efficiency and potentially causing damage. We recommend flushing your water heater at least once a year to remove sediment and maintain optimal performance.
